Lakeview's game last Friday was a loss, but they didn't let that memory haunt them on Monday. In a tight contest that could have gone either way, they made off with a 42-41 win over the Merrill Vandals. The victory was some much needed relief for the Wildcats as it spelled an end to their five-game losing streak.

Lakeview's win ended a three-game drought on the road and puts them at 4-10. As for Merrill, they have traveled a rocky road recently having lost eight of their last nine games, which put a noticeable dent in their 3-10 record this season.
Lakeview will venture away from home to challenge Kent City at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. As for Merrill, they will host Vestaburg at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day.
